Output 3d1324e20ef8eccd7ae90a859e08a1a7207a4787acc3dd05c6dfa46d2310c167:0

value
49929996
script pubkey
OP_0 OP_PUSHBYTES_20 58524970b94c228dbdf265b281ddb0c13571de85
address
tb1qtpfyju9efs3gm00jvkegrhdscy6hrh59fvqgwh
transaction
3d1324e20ef8eccd7ae90a859e08a1a7207a4787acc3dd05c6dfa46d2310c167
confirmations
228397
spent
true